Create a section in the script and type the following. Calling svd for numeric matrices that are not symbolic objects invokes the matlab svd function.

The second arguments 0 and econ only affect the shape of the returned matrices. Removing these zeros and columns can improve execution time and reduce storage requirements without compromising the accuracy of the decomposition.
